About

Dog Park at Dix Park is a premier off-leash destination for dogs and their owners in Raleigh, North Carolina. Located at 1800 Umstead Drive, this highly-rated park features an expansive off-leash area where your furry friend can run, play, and socialize with other dogs. Beyond the dog park itself, visitors enjoy access to beautiful scenic trails that wind through the park grounds, perfect for extended adventures with your pup. With extended daily hours from 8 AM to 9 PM, seven days a week, the Dog Park at Dix Park accommodates your schedule. Plenty of parking. Two areas for large breed dogs and one area for small breed/puppies. They have shade covering so you’re not fully in the sun the whole time. They have grass area. They also have a lot of dirt area. The thing I would like them to have more of our trash…

Awesome dog park! It’s massive—has three different sections (one of which is always closed to help the grass grow back). Very clean and well kept. Definitely recommend visiting.

It gets pretty busy but it’s a great urban dog park with a ton of space and multiple fenced-in areas. There is water on site and a large dedicated parking lot right next to the entrance. Our dogs had lots of fun fetching balls and playing with the other pups!
